Appeal Court Judge abducted, police orderly killed

The Police on Wednesday in Benin, confirmed the kidnap of Justice Chioma Nwosu of the Court Of Appeal, Benin Division.
The judge was kidnapped by  gunmen in Benin, in the  early hours of Wednesday.
The police orderly accompanying the judge, Inspector A. I. Momoh, was killed by the gunmen before taking the victim away.
Edo State Police Command spokesman, DSP Chidi Nwabuzor, said the incident occurred about 11.30 a.m., along the Benin-Agbor Expressway, at Christ Chosen Church of God International.
According to him “The victim, Justice Chioma Nwosu was attacked, while the police orderly attached to her, Inspector A. I. Momoh, was murdered and the driver of the vehicle severely injured and was rushed to a nearby hospital for treatment.
“Immediately, the police operatives at Ikpoba Hill Divisional Police Headquarters, the tactical team of Edo command and other relevant sections, swung into action.
“Investigation is ongoing and by the Grace of God, Justice Chioma Nwosu will be rescued unhurt,” he said.
